    Kyiv Polytechnic shows notable advances in key QS WUR indicators

    According to the 23rd edition of the QS World University Rankings (WUR), the Igor Sikorsky Kyiv Polytechnic Institute has been named as one of the world’s top universities, ranking in the 851–900 band globally and sharing second place with the V.N.     ATHENA Cluster Leaders meet at the University of Siegen

    On June 10 and 11, ATHENA Cluster Leaders met for a strategic and organisational session at the INCYTE Research Center of the University of Siegen. ATHENA focuses its activities on four clusters: Digitalization for All, Sustainable Production, Health & Wellbeing, and Creative Industries.     Cooperation in humanitarian mine action with MAT Kosovo under discussion

    A delegation of the international organisation PCM & MAT Kosovo (Republic of Malta) visited the Igor Sikorsky Kyiv Polytechnic Institute. During the visit, discussions focused on prospects for establishing the international training centre of mine safety and humanitarian mine action at Kyiv Polytechnic.     Kyiv Polytechnic celebrates Vyshyvanka Day

    21 May is a special day, filled with warmth, unity and Ukrainian indomitable spirit. This year marks the 20th anniversary of Vyshyvanka (Embroidered Shirt) Day, a celebration that has long become a cherished tradition at the Igor Sikorsky Kyiv Polytechnic Institute.
